Ingredients:

- 1 cup Tur dal
- ½ cup mung dal
- ½ cup masoor dal
- 3 tbsp channa dal
- 7 tbsp oil
- 1 tsp mustard seeds
- ¾ tsp cumin seeds
- 5 slit green chillies
- 1 tsp turmeric powder
- 1 ½ medium chopped onion
- 2 medium chopped tomatoes
- ½ tsp hing (asafetida)
- 1 or 2 sprigs curry leaves (handful)
- 1 tsp crushed ginger (Optional)
- 1 tsp crushed garlic (Optional)
Direction to cook:
- Wash all the dals and keep it aside
- Heat oil in a pan and add mustard seeds and let it splutter
- Now add cumin seed and stir the mix. Immediately add chopped onions so that the cumin seeds and mustard seeds does not get burnt. Stir the mixture again.
- Now you can add green chillies and let it fry for a minute
- Now add crushed garlic and ginger and let it fry for a minute after stirring
- Add asafetida, curry leaves and turmeric powder and stir the mixture,
- After a minutes add tomatoes and stir again
- Once the tomatoes have melted, add the washed dal and stir the mixture
- Add enough water that it is slightly above the dal mixture in the pan
- Pressure cook till the dal is soft as per your desire
- I like my dal to be super soft and so I allow upto 4 whistles in the cooker. Also every cooker is different so you can give around 3 whistles first and after removing the pressure you can check to see if it has reached your desired consistency. If not, allow it to pressure cook for another 2 whistles.
- Your mixed dal is now ready
Enjoy with rice or flat bread or naan.
